The Levantine Ceramics Project (LCP) is an open-access database of ceramic wares, shapes, and laboratory analyses produced anywhere in the Levant, which includes the modern nations of Turkey, Syria, Lebanon, Cyprus, Israel, Jordan, Palestine, and Egypt. The focus is on ceramics of all eras—from the Neolithic era (c. 5500 B.C.E.) through the Ottoman period (c. 1920 C.E.).
